How much does a Lending Agent make in Denver, CO?

As of April 01, 2025, the average annual salary for a Lending Agent in Denver, CO is $53,843. Salary.com reports that pay typically ranges from $46,223 to $61,644, with most professionals earning between $39,284 and $68,747.

What is a Lending Agent?

A Lending Agent is responsible for evaluating and processing loan applications from individuals or businesses. They review financial documents, credit reports, and other relevant information to determine the borrower's creditworthiness and ability to repay the loan. Lending agents also work with clients to explain loan options, terms, and conditions, and assist them in completing the application process. They may also be responsible for negotiating loan terms and ensuring that all necessary paperwork is completed accurately and in a timely manner. Additionally, lending agents may be involved in marketing and promoting loan products to potential clients. Overall, their primary goal is to facilitate the lending process and help clients secure the financing they need.

What is the average salary for Lending Agent in 2025?
These charts show the average base salary (core compensation), as well as the average total cash compensation for the job of Lending Agent in Denver, CO. The base salary for Lending Agent ranges from $46,223 to $61,644 with the average base salary of $53,843. The total cash compensation, which includes base, and annual incentives, can vary anywhere from $47,315 to $65,400 with the average total cash compensation of $55,703.
Average Salary Average Salary Range
Base Salary $53,843 $46,223 - $61,644
Bonus $1,860 $1,092 - $3,756
Total Pay $55,703 $47,315 - $65,400
* Base Salary represents gross income before taxes and deductions. It does not include additional pay such as benefits, bonuses, profit sharing or commissions.
* Total Pay combines base salary, bonuses, profit sharing, tips, commissions, overtime pay and other forms of cash earnings, as applicable for this job.
